The Welterbe Oberes Mittelrheintal, or Upper Middle Rhine Valley, is a UNESCO World Heritage site that captivates tourists with its stunning landscapes, rich history, and charming towns. Nestled along the Rhine River, it’s a paradise for nature lovers, history enthusiasts, and anyone seeking a picturesque getaway. Explore the vineyards, castles, and quaint villages that dot this enchanting region, offering unforgettable experiences for every traveler.

- Visit during the grape harvest season in late summer for vibrant scenery and local wine festivals.
- Take a river cruise for a unique perspective of the valley's castles and vineyards.
- Explore the hiking trails for breathtaking views of the Rhine and its surroundings.
- Try the local Riesling wines at nearby vineyards to truly taste the region.
- Plan your visit around local festivals for a deeper cultural experience.

Getting There
-
Car
If you're traveling by car, start by getting onto the A61 motorway. Follow signs for Boppard or Sankt Goar. Take the exit toward B42/Boppard/Sankt Goar and merge onto B42. Continue on B42 until you reach the signs for Sankt Goarshausen. Once in Sankt Goarshausen, follow the local road signs to Welterbe Oberes Mittelrheintal, located at 4PRH+56. Parking may be available nearby, but be sure to check local parking regulations.
-
Train
For those using public transportation, take a train to Sankt Goarshausen from major cities like Koblenz or Mainz. The regional trains (RE) operate frequently, and you can check the schedule on the Deutsche Bahn website. Once you arrive at Sankt Goarshausen train station, exit the station and it's a short walk to Welterbe Oberes Mittelrheintal, located at 4PRH+56. Follow the signs or use a map app for precise navigation.
-
Bus
You can also reach Sankt Goarshausen by bus. Various bus services connect the surrounding towns and cities to Sankt Goarshausen. Check the local bus schedules for routes and times. Once you arrive at the bus station in Sankt Goarshausen, the Welterbe Oberes Mittelrheintal is within walking distance. Follow the signs or use a map app for directions to 4PRH+56.
-
Walking
If you are already in Sankt Goarshausen, you can easily walk to Welterbe Oberes Mittelrheintal. Head south towards the river, and follow the riverside path or local streets towards the address at 4PRH+56. The walk is scenic and allows you to enjoy the beautiful views of the Rhine Valley.
